Purchasing Power Analysis

A Chemical Engineers in Southbury, CT earns $64,000 in nominal terms, which is 28.9% below the national average of $90,000. After adjusting for the local cost of living (index 112.8 vs national 100), this is equivalent to $56,738 in national-average purchasing power.

Tax differences are not included. Only cost-of-living index adjustments are applied.
